Zantac Heartburn Medication Recalled After Cancer Risk Scare

Pharmaceutical manufacturer GlaxoSmithKline (GSK) is recalling the popular heartburn drug Zantac in all markets as a “precaution,” just days after the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) found “unacceptable” levels of a probable cancer-causing impurity known as N-Nitrosodimethylamine (NDMA). Legislation Capping Nicotine in E-Cigarettes to Be Introduced

New legislation will be introduced in Congress that would cap the amount of nicotine in e-cigarettes to combat their use among young people. Concentrations to Be Capped at 20 Milligrams Per Milliliter On October 7, 2019, Rep. Raja Krishnamoorthi announced the introduction of the END ENDS Act. New Seatbelt Requirements in Wake of Deadly Limo Crash

The National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) is calling for new limo seatbelt requirements in the wake of a deadly limo crash in upstate New York. Agency Proposes Tighter Safety Regulations The NTSB’s safety recommendations were released on October 2, 2019, nearly a year after a notorious limo crash that left twenty people dead. GWC Injury Lawyers LLC Response to Sterigenics Closing

On September 30, 2019, Sterigenics abruptly announced that they were abandoning their attempt to reopen the Willowbrook facility that was shut down after state officials found elevated levels of toxic ethylene oxide being released into residential neighborhoods. CEO Resigns as Juul Halts Advertising, Agrees to Flavored Vape Ban

The Chief Executive Officer of Juul Labs, the leading vaping company in the United States, has stepped down amidst a wave of vaping-related illnesses and deaths.
